The Josephine County Sheriff’s Office announced on March 25 that a fatal single-vehicle crash occurred late the previous night on Three Pines Road near Monument Drive. The incident resulted in the death of Richard David Johnson, age 50, who was pronounced deceased at the scene.
According to authorities, the crash took place at approximately 10:57 p.m. on March 24. First responders arrived after a 9-1-1 call and found that Johnson’s vehicle had veered off the roadway for unknown reasons before striking a fence and a large tree. The cause of why the vehicle left the road remains under investigation.
Three Pines Road was closed for about two and a half hours while deputies conducted their investigation and removed the vehicle from the area. The sheriff’s office confirmed that next of kin has been notified.
